Purpose of the Main Bearing Kit

The primary function of the Main Bearing Kit is to support the crankshaft, a central engine component. By providing a smooth surface for rotation, the main bearings minimize friction and wear, ensuring the crankshaft’s stability and the engine’s efficient operation. The kit includes precision-engineered bearings that fit snugly within the engine block, maintaining correct tolerances for optimal performance 1.

Key Features

This Cummins part is characterized by several key features that enhance performance and durability. The bearings are typically made from a combination of steel backing and a Babbitt lining, offering a soft, compliant surface that absorbs shocks and vibrations. The design includes precise tolerances for a proper fit within the engine block. Additionally, the kit may include shims or spacers for fine adjustments during installation, ensuring optimal clearance and performance 2.

Installation Process

Installing the Cummins 5406110 Main Bearing Kit requires careful attention to detail to ensure proper fit and function. The process begins with the preparation of the engine block, which involves cleaning the bearing surfaces to remove any debris or old bearing material. The new bearings are then installed into the engine block, taking care to align them correctly. Any necessary shims or spacers are added to achieve the correct clearance between the bearings and the crankshaft. Finally, the crankshaft is installed, and the engine is reassembled, following the manufacturer’s guidelines to ensure a successful installation.

Maintenance and Troubleshooting

To maintain the Cummins 5406110 Main Bearing Kit and ensure optimal performance, regular inspections and maintenance are recommended. This includes checking for signs of wear or damage on the bearings and ensuring that the clearances are within specifications. Common issues may include excessive wear, which can be identified by increased noise or vibration from the engine. Troubleshooting these problems may involve inspecting the crankshaft for damage or misalignment, as well as ensuring that the engine oil is clean and at the correct level to provide adequate lubrication.

Components of Cummins 5406110 Main Bearing Kit

Main Bearing (3678555 and 3678556)

The Cummins 5406110 Main Bearing Kit includes two main bearings identified by the part numbers 3678555 and 3678556. These bearings are essential components of the kit, designed to support the crankshaft within the engine block. They facilitate smooth rotation of the crankshaft by minimizing friction and wear. Each main bearing is precision-engineered to ensure optimal performance and longevity, contributing to the overall efficiency and reliability of the engine.

Crankshaft Thrust Bearing (3691445)

The crankshaft thrust bearing, denoted by the part number 3691445, is another critical component included in the Cummins 5406110 Main Bearing Kit. This bearing is responsible for managing axial loads and preventing the crankshaft from moving excessively within the engine block. By providing a stable and secure interface, the crankshaft thrust bearing ensures that the crankshaft maintains proper alignment and operates within specified tolerances. This component plays a vital role in enhancing the durability and performance of the engine by reducing wear and tear on the crankshaft and related components.
